The upper bar displays time, successfully connected Neoré route (cloud) service
and Ethernet connection.
Heatpump operation. For heating / cooling / DHW heating is used heat pump.
Secondary source operation. For heating is used secondary source. For DHW heating is used heat pump.
Defrost. Outdoor unit defrosts. DHW heating is interrupted.
Too low temperature of outdoor air. For heating is fully used bivalent source (internal electric heater).
Economic operation. Displayed when output water temp. is lower than 45°C and the power is lower than 50%.
DHW heating is blocked by time schedule
Antilegionella. DHW tank is heated by electric heater because of legionella desinfection

Meaning of text shortcuts
Attenuation
- attenuation is active, parameter settings in section Object
High tariff
!
- operation is blocked by electricity supplier
DHW heat.
- DHW heating by heat pump
DHW el. heat.
- DHW heating by electric heater
Drying
- floor drying program is active
Pool heat.
- pool is heated by heat pump
Bival 1st. 2st.
- bivalent source operation (1st. - first stage (2kW), 2st. - second stage (4kW))
Outd. T
- outdoor air temperature
Outp. T
- output water temperature
Equi. T
- temperature computed by equithermal curve for primary circuit
Circ.
- circulator power
Obj. T
- object temperature
IQ corr.
- IQ correction - correction applied to equithermal curve by object temperature
